Luna describes a winter night in 2018 when she stopped at a deserted roadside diner in Dunlow, West Virginia. A single record player sat on the counter, its needle stuck in a groove that played a woman's voice saying something in a language that sounded like English but wasn't. She tried to leave three times but the road kept looping back. By the time she got home, the record was in her coat pocket.
